xentrace: fix t_info_pages calculation for the default case
The default tracebuffer size of 32 pages was not tested with the previous patch.
As a result, t_info_pages will become zero and alloc_xenheap_pages() fails.
Catch this case and allocate at least one page.
Signed-off-by: Olaf Hering <olaf@aepfle.de>
diff -r c81f0ef5a77d -r 08df96398bff xen/common/trace.c
--- a/xen/common/trace.c Mon Mar 21 14:52:27 2011 +0000
+++ b/xen/common/trace.c Tue Mar 22 18:08:05 2011 +0100
@@ -125,7 +125,7 @@
t_info_pages = num_online_cpus() * pages + t_info_first_offset;
t_info_pages *= sizeof(uint32_t);
t_info_pages /= PAGE_SIZE;
- if ( t_info_pages % PAGE_SIZE )
+ if ( t_info_pages % PAGE_SIZE || t_info_pages == 0 )
t_info_pages++;
return pages;
}
